Kawasaki diagnostic criteria
| Classic clinical criteria | |
|---|---|
| Fever persisting for at least 5 days | |
| Plus | |
| At least 4 of the following principle features: | |
| 1. Extremity changes | Erythema of palms/soles, edema of hands/feet, periungual peeling of fingers, toes in weeks 2–3 |
| 2. Rash | Polymorphous exanthema, NOT bullous/vesicular |
| 3. Changes in lips and oral cavity | Erythema, cracked lips, strawberry tongue, diffuse injection of oral and pharyngeal mucosa |
| 4. Conjunctival injection | Bilateral, bulbar sparing limbus, non-purulent |
| 5. Cervical lymphadenopathy | > 1.5 cm in diameter, usually unilateral |
| Supplemental laboratory criteria | |
| Hypoalbuminia | < 3.0 mg/dL |
| Alanine aminotransferase (ALT) | Elevation above reference range (varies by laboratory) |
| Anemia for age | Decreased in hemoglobin below reference range for age |
| Leukocytosis | White blood cells > 15,000/mm3 |
| Sterile pyuria (urinalysis) | |
| Thrombocytosis after 7 days | Platelets > 450,000/mm3 after 7 days |

CDC MIS-C case definition
| Criteria | Specifications |
|---|---|
| Age | < 21 years |
| AND | |
| Fever | > 38.0 °C for ≥ 24 h or report of subjective fever ≥ 24 h |
| AND | |
| Laboratory evidence of inflammation | ≥ 1 of the following: CRP, ESR, fibrinogen, procalcitonin, |
| AND | |
| Evidence of clinically significant illness requiring hospitalization with multisystem organ involvement | > 2 organ involvement (cardiac, kidney, respiratory, hematologic, gastrointestinal, dermatologic, neurological) |
| AND | |
| Evidence of recent or current SARS-CoV-2 infection | Positive RT-PCR, serology, antigen test, or COVID-19 exposure within the 4 weeks prior to the onset of symptoms |
| AND | |
| No alternative plauusible diagnoses |
